Our Limited Edition Collection would not be complete without a special Holiday Fragrance.

Nourouz, named for the New Year celebration traditional in Persia, is as exciting as it’s name.  Based on luscious tamarind and sensuous paprika, this is a perfume that smolders and sizzles.  Rest assured, I don’t leave home without it all year long.

    Wow, I am so pleased to see that this fragrance is currently a DSH ‘bestseller’! I bought this fragrance when it was the December 2007 Holiday perfume known as Tamarind/Paprika. I fell for it instantly; its deep, dry spiciness, the peppery kick of paprika, and the pulpy, pungent tamarind are intriguing topnotes. In the drydown, a definite tobacco note emerges, along with a dark red rose, a hint of orris, and a very dark, unsweetened vanilla. The scent becomes richer and more dimensional over time. If you like Miller et Bertaux #2 Spiritus/Land, YSL Nu, or other dry and spicy Oriental scents, you will enjoy this. If you love Chergui (as I do), but sometimes are in the mood for a less sweet version, give this a try. I continue to wear and love this fragrance.
